Transaction dccc26d2ae7537aabab689ebf1bd588af361c260071d19ea82394494081e1bfb
1 Input
1 Output
-
dccc26d2ae7537aabab689ebf1bd588af361c260071d19ea82394494081e1bfb:0
- value
- 138956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 244eaf1688edb43b6c30e19b8c8de73f3a709784 OP_EQUAL
- address
- 34zzWWGgQicYtMCJUs3ccfJ7hTQu4BexZw